Job Title: Civil EngineerJob Description
This role supports the planning, design, and technical execution of civil engineering projects, with a focus on site and land development. You will complete engineering assignments using established standards, assist in preparing design plans, specifications, and cost estimates, and contribute to both office-based design work and field-based observations. This entry-level to early-career position is designed to build your professional engineering skills through hands-on project exposure, close collaboration with experienced engineers and surveyors, and progressive responsibility on a variety of civil engineering projects.

Work Environment
The role is based in a growing office of approximately ten professionals, including civil engineers, drafters, and surveyors. You will work primarily in an office setting, with an estimated 75% of your time dedicated to design and technical work and about 25% spent in the field on site visits and observations, though this balance may vary by project. You will report within a local leadership structure and receive direct mentorship and training from a licensed Professional Engineer, allowing you to accrue experience hours toward licensure. The team culture emphasizes collaboration, open communication, problem-solving, and dependable client service, with regular interaction among engineers, surveyors, and technical staff. The organization provides hands-on exposure to design, field work, and client interaction, and supports growth into roles with greater design ownership and eventual project management responsibilities. Work is performed using standard office tools and engineering technologies, including Civil 3D, AutoCAD, and related design software, in a professional, team-oriented environment.
